London: The Press Art School, no date [1918]. [Art Reference] ORIGINAL PORTFOLIOS. Fifteen parts out of twenty. Folio (41 x 28cm), each part having a letter-press text of six leaves, including a half-tone photographic portrait of the illustrator tipped in as a frontispiece, as well as six mounted half-tone illustrated plates (some in colour) showing progressive stages in the development of a drawing by the illustrator. Each part contained within a grey card portfolio, bound with thick string. Black titles to upper of each portfolio. Including parts 1; 2; 4; 5; 6; 7; 8; 9; 11; 12; 13; 14; 15; 16; and 20, each containing an account of particular illustrator's life and work, together with mounted half-tone reproductions loosely inserted in a portfolio illustrating six stages in the development of a drawing.
